Why did UAB Buy St. Vincent’s Hospital?
Why did UAB Buy St. Vincent’s Hospital?

The University of Alabama at Birmingham (UAB) Health System's acquisition of St. Vincent's Health System from Ascension is a strategic move aimed at expanding healthcare services, improving patient care, and enhancing medical education in the region. An alliance was formed a few years prior to this acquisition. Such an alliance allowed high volume sports medicine surgeons like myself to utilize St Vincent’s 119 Outpatient Surgery Center Facility to perform cases in a more efficient manner. Market consolidation appears to be occurring across multiple practices and healthcare entities in the Untied States.

Here are key reasons behind this purchase:

  1. Expanded Reach: The acquisition increases UAB's footprint in the Birmingham metro market, allowing it to reach a broader patient base and provide comprehensive care to more individuals.
  2. Enhanced Services: St. Vincent's brings specialized services like obstetrics and cardiovascular care, complementing UAB's existing offerings and creating a more robust healthcare network.
  3. Improved Coordination: Integrating St. Vincent's into the UAB system enables seamless referrals, streamlined care transitions, and better coordination between healthcare providers. Historically, many complex and sick patients have been transferred from St. Vincent’s to UAB for higher level care.
  4. Medical Education: The acquisition strengthens UAB's position as a leading academic medical center, providing students and residents with diverse training opportunities and access to a wider range of clinical experiences.
  5. Economies of Scale: Consolidation allows for cost savings through shared resources, reduced administrative burdens, and optimized operations. Blue Cross Blue Shield has a monopoly in the state when it comes to insurance, and historically, reimbursement rates have been depressed in Alabama compared to surrounding states.
  6. Competition and Market Dynamics: The purchase prevents potential competitors from acquiring St. Vincent's, maintaining UAB's market position and ensuring continued innovation and investment in local healthcare.
  7. Alignment with UAB's Mission: The acquisition supports UAB's commitment to delivering high-quality patient care, advancing medical research, and improving community health outcomes.
